Chlorella and spirulina are types of algae that have been gaining reputation in the complement world. This text reviews the differences between chlorella and spirulina and assesses whether one is healthier. Chlorella and spirulina are the most popular algae supplements in the marketplace. While each boast a formidable nutritional profile and related well being benefits, they've several differences. Chlorella and spirulina ship numerous nutrients. While their protein, carbohydrate, and fat compositions are very similar, their most notable nutritional differences lie in their calorie, vitamin, and mineral contents. In addition to their excessive levels of polyunsaturated fat, each chlorella and spirulina are very excessive in antioxidants. In a single research, 52 people who smoked cigarettes had been supplemented with 6.3 grams of chlorella or a placebo for six weeks. In another research, 30 folks with ch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) consumed either 1 or 2 grams of spirulina day by day for 60 days. Participants skilled up to a 20% improve in blood levels of the antioxidant enzyme superoxide dismutase, and as much as a 29% improve in vitamin C levels. Chlorella is wealthy in omega-three fatty acids, vitamin A, riboflavin, iron, and zinc. Spirulina comprises extra thiamine, copper, and probably more protein. Numerous research have shown that each chlorella and spirulina could benefit blood sugar administration. Insulin sensitivity is a measure of how nicely your cells respond to the hormone insulin, which shuttles glucose (blood sugar) out of the blood and into cells the place it can be used for power. Furthermore, brain health gummies a number of human studies have found that taking chlorella supplements may increase blood sugar management and insulin sensitivity. Some analysis reveals that spirulina and chlorella may help decrease blood sugar levels and improve insulin sensitivity. Studies have proven that chlorella and spirulina have the potential to enhance heart well being by affecting your blood lipid composition and blood pressure levels. Similarly to chlorella, spirulina could profit your cholesterol profile and blood pressure. Studies have found that both chlorella and spirulina could help enhance your cholesterol profile and reduce your blood stress levels. Which one is healthier? Both forms of algae include excessive amounts of nutrients. However, chlorella is greater in omega-three fatty acids, vitamin A, riboflavin, iron, magnesium, and zinc. The high levels of polyunsaturated fats, antioxidants, and other vitamins current in chlorella give it a slight nutritional advantage over spirulina. However, each supply their very own unique advantages. One isn’t essentially better than the other.
